The Givenchy Spring 2018 Couture Runway: A Symphony of Craftsmanship and Confidence

The Spring 2018 Couture show took place within the hallowed halls of the Archives Nationales in Paris, a setting that perfectly echoed the collection's reverence for tradition while simultaneously embracing a contemporary spirit. Waight Keller, in her second couture outing for Givenchy, demonstrated a clear understanding of the house's DNA, paying homage to Hubert de Givenchy's elegant and refined aesthetic while injecting her own signature touch of modern femininity and strength.

The runway was a visual feast, a carefully curated selection of looks that showcased the exceptional craftsmanship of the Givenchy atelier. The collection was characterized by its exquisite tailoring, intricate embellishments, and a sophisticated color palette dominated by black, white, and ivory, punctuated by flashes of vibrant hues like fuchsia, emerald green, and sapphire blue.

Key Runway Looks: Decoding the Collection's Narrative

Several looks stood out as particularly representative of the collection's overall theme:

* The Power Suit Reinvented: Waight Keller reimagined the classic power suit, softening its traditionally masculine silhouette with rounded shoulders, cinched waists, and flowing trousers. These suits, often rendered in luxurious fabrics like silk and velvet, exuded confidence and sophistication, reflecting the designer's vision of the modern woman. One standout example was a black velvet suit with sharp, yet softened, shoulders and a dramatically wide-legged trouser, paired with a delicate lace camisole beneath.

* The Ethereal Gown: The collection also featured a series of ethereal gowns that showcased the exceptional artistry of the Givenchy atelier. These gowns, often crafted from layers of delicate tulle, silk chiffon, and lace, were adorned with intricate embellishments such as feathers, sequins, and hand-embroidered floral motifs. One particularly memorable gown was a floor-length creation in shimmering silver, featuring a cascading train and intricate beading that resembled a starry night sky.vogue givenchy spring 2018

* The Bold Statement Piece: Contrasting with the softer, more romantic elements of the collection, Waight Keller also incorporated bold statement pieces that added a touch of edge and modernity. These included structured jackets with exaggerated shoulders, asymmetrical dresses with daring cutouts, and dramatic capes that commanded attention. A prime example was a black leather jacket with sculpted shoulders, paired with a flowing silk skirt, creating a striking juxtaposition of strength and femininity.

* The Artistic Touch: The collection featured several pieces that highlighted Givenchy's collaboration with artists. These included hand-painted dresses with abstract designs and gowns adorned with intricate embroideries inspired by contemporary art. This artistic collaboration added another layer of depth and complexity to the collection, demonstrating Waight Keller's commitment to pushing the boundaries of couture.

Beauty and Models: Complementing the Garments

The beauty look for the Givenchy Spring 2018 Couture show was understated yet impactful. Makeup artist Pat McGrath created a fresh, dewy complexion with subtly defined eyes and nude lips, allowing the garments to take center stage. The hair, styled by Guido Palau, was sleek and sophisticated, often pulled back into low ponytails or chignons, further emphasizing the collection's refined aesthetic.

The casting of models was equally strategic. Waight Keller selected a diverse group of women who embodied the collection's spirit of confidence and individuality. The models, ranging in age, ethnicity, and body type, reflected the designer's commitment to inclusivity and representation. Notable models who graced the runway included Kaia Gerber, Anok Yai, and Natalia Vodianova, each bringing their unique presence and personality to the collection.
